'We are not in the clear yet,' says Los Angeles fire chief

Jan 14, 2025

Los Angeles [US], January 14: The Los Angeles Fire Department is warning of dangerous weather conditions that could reignite the fires in the US West Coast metropolis.
Dry conditions and fast winds spell a high risk of fire in the greater Los Angeles area, LA County Fire Chief Anthony Marrone said. Los Angeles Fire Chief Kristin Crowley made it clear that danger has not yet been averted. "We are not in the clear as of yet," she added. "We must not let our guard down."
Los Angeles County Sheriff Robert Luna emphasized that emergency services were continuing to search for missing people in the affected areas. He spoke of a "horrific" task. Luna expects that more bodies will be found in the ruins.
According to the police, there have been 14 arrests in connection with the blazes so far. Suspects have been detained for violating curfews, breaking and entering, vandalism and shoplifting. (DPA)
